A crucial part of learning how to learn is becoming acutely aware of the obstacles that block our path to excellence.

Here we look at three dysfunctional characters – the Dabbler, the Hack, and the Obsessive. These are the three learner profiles you want to avoid. Together they’ll give you a spookily accurate assessment of how you prevent yourself reaching true competence and expertise.
